If the revenue for the week is $2000 and the labor cost consists of two workers earning eight dollars per hour who work 40 hours
arsen [322]
To find the cost of labor for one worker, you multiply the wage by the number of hours worked. 

40 * 8 = 320

Because there are two workers, now you double it. 

320 * 2 = 640

To find the percentage of the revenue that this is, you do the labor cost divided by the revenue. 

640 / 2000 = 0.32

Move the decimal two places to the right to get the percentage. 

0.32 = 32%

The labor cost is 32% of the revenue.
